Setting Up a Burst Signal
Setting Up a Burst Signal
Task
Set up a burst signal consisting of a 32-bit data pattern repeated
twice at a period of 500 ps with 50 ps delay and 100 ps pulse
width.
The data pattern is: 10100000000000000000000000000000
The amplitude is 2.0 V and the offset is 0 V.
Start the output at the rising edge of an external signal with 1 V
threshold applied at the start input.
Using the Graphical User Interface
Instrument Settings
To set the instrument parameters:
1 Disable the outputs.
2 In the instrument panel, choose the Burst mode.
3 Set the burst repetition to 2.
4 Set the Period to 500 ps.
